8. How to Use & Care for Your FlawlessCore Brush
- Prime & Dispense: Pump your preferred liquid or cream foundation onto the back of your hand.
- Dab & Distribute: Lightly press the flat top of FlawlessCore into the product.
- Buff in Tiny Circles: Starting at the center of your face, buff outward in circular motions until seamless.
- Conceal & Contour: Use the tapered edge around nose and under‐eye for precision.
Cleaning Routine:
- Weekly Deep Clean: Apply a small amount of gentle, alcohol-free brush cleanser and lukewarm water. Massage bristles on a silicone pad for 20–30 seconds.
- Rinse & Reshape: Rinse until water runs clear, reshape the dome, and lay flat to dry (4 hours).
- Quick Rinse: For busy days, use a spray-on brush‐sanitizer between washes—FlawlessCore’s Hydro-Repel finish prevents product buildup.
